ROJAS BENITES, Daniella S; REPO DE CARRASCO, Ritva  and  ENCINA ZELADA, Christian R. Determination of maximun retention of bioactive compounds and antioxidant capacity on nectar of tree tomato (Solanum betaceaum Cav.). Rev. Soc. Quím. Perú [online]. 2017, vol.83, n.2, pp.174-186. ISSN 1810-634X.

The appropriate parameters to produce nectar of tree tomato (Solanum betaceaum Cav.), with a greater retention on the content of ascorbic acid, phenolic compounds, total carotenoids and antioxidant capacity that are present in the raw material, were established. The content of bioactive compounds in the tree tomato pulp was determined: total carotenoids with 4,27 mg β-carotene/100g, vitamin C with 28,83 mg ascorbic acid/ 100g, phenolic compounds with 100,55 mg AGE/100g and the antioxidant capacity with 3,3172 μmol trolox/g measured by the DPPH method and 4,6551 μmol trolox/g measured by the ABTS method. A greater retention on the bioactive compounds and antioxidant capacity on the tree tomato nectar was obtained at a pH of 3,33, °Brix of 13, dilution water:pulp of 1:2,5 and a pasteurization temperature of 99,5°C for 1 minute, finding on it a content of 1,68 mg β-carotene/100g, vitamin C of 11,45 mg de ascorbic acid/100g, phenolic compounds of de 32,96 mg AGE/100g y the antioxidant capacity of de 1,3803 μmol trolox/g measured by the DPPH method and 2,0006 μmol trolox/g measured by the ABTS method

Keywords : tree tomato; ascorbic acid; phenolic compounds; total carotenoids; antioxidant capacity; nectar.
